Yarroweyah, Victoria

Yarroweyah is a town in northern Victoria, Australia. The town is located in the Shire of Moira local government area, 251 kilometres north of the state capital, Melbourne and 10 kilometres west of Cobram. The town is situated near the intersection of Kenny Road, Kokoda Road and the Murray Valley Highway. At the 2006 census, Yarroweyah and the surrounding area had a population of 1,140.

Koonoomoo, Victoria

Koonoomoo is a town in northern Victoria, Australia. The town is located in the Shire of Moira local government area, 264 kilometres north of the state capital, Melbourne on the Goulburn Valley Highway, near the Murray River. The town is probably best known for its strawberry farms and the Big Strawberry, part of an Australian trend to build large roadside attractions. Also it is home to the Cobram State Forest which attracts many visitors.
